Overview

This is the iMedia Browser framework that is used by a number of applications (and as the basis for a stand-alone utility). Developers are encouraged to include this in their application as long as there is proper attribution.

Sandboxing

We are in the process of getting iMedia sandbox-friendly on the sandbox-compatibility branch. It is working with the following caveats:

  • Search the headers for SANDBOXING to make sure your app has the entitlements iMedia needs
  • Custom folders are not supported yet. If the user drags one in, the browser will lose access to it the next time the OS boots
  • iMovie Sound Effects have been removed on the basis that Apple doesn't want us poking around another app's resources

There is also a longer-term effort in the iMediaSandboxing fork to farm out parsing to XPC processes.

Compatibility

2.5

Out of the box (the master branch), iMedia supports OS X 10.6 Snow Leopard and later. It is suitable for both 32 and 64 bit apps.

2.1

For apps still supporting OS X 10.5 Leopard, we continue to support the existing iMedia 2.1 codebase on the maintain-leopard-compatible branch.

1.x

For the older 1.x branch, which is not being maintained, you can get it from subversion:

svn checkout http://imedia.googlecode.com/svn/trunk/ imedia-read-only

Recent Release Notes

2.5.1

  • The +[IMBConfig registerDefaultValues] method has been made private. You should have no need to call it in your app as IMBConfig automatically runs that routine the first time it is used
